Subject: Large-deal discount policy update

Executive team,

Finance has completed the review of discounting on enterprise deals over the Marrow-tier threshold. Average realized discount was 21%, versus the 14% modeled in the annual plan. Effective next month: discounts above 16% require finance approval, and bundled Claravale services may no longer be given away to close. Templates are updated in the deal desk portal. The confidential business rationale is appended below.

internal memo for kawip-hadug: Headcount on the Wenwyn team goes from 7 to 140 by the end of January. Gross margin on Wenwyn came in at 20 percent against a plan of 15 percent.

Subject: Cut-over done — export retries

Hi Mirelle,

Quick recap: we finished the Quillhaven cut-over last night. Failed exports now go through the new retry queue instead of silently dying — three attempts with backoff, then a dead-letter bin that ops reviews daily. Nothing sensitive leaves the Tovern region during retries; payloads stay encrypted at rest the whole time. We'd love your sign-off before we widen the rollout. For your review, here are the settings we shipped with.

deployment values, kajep-kageg:
[praix]
host = praix.paliqcorp.corp
user = praix_svc
database = praix_prod

The revamped password reset flow in the Lockstone API replaces emailed links with short-lived reset grants. Plugins initiate a reset by posting the account handle to the reset endpoint, then poll the grant status until the user confirms out-of-band. Grants expire after ten minutes and are single-use; a consumed grant returns a terminal status rather than an error. All reset endpoints require plugin-level authentication via the bearer token shown below.

bearer token for yajop-tahop: eyJhbGciOiJIUzI1NiIsInR5cCI6IkpXVCJ9.eyJzdWIiOiIC9r503In0.M9JwY-EN

Title: Split user module out of Harrowdeck monolith

Priority: High. The user module blocks independent deploys; every auth change forces a full Harrowdeck release. Plan: extract profile and session code into a standalone service behind the Lattice gateway, dual-write for two sprints, then cut over. No schema changes in phase one. Release manager: gate the cutover on the canary build referenced below.

pipeline stamp: htk31_0320b403a7d85d795607a9e75b13f71